Ticket: PUB-API pagination drift between prod nodes. Heads up — two of the four Lattice API nodes are serving different default page sizes, so clients hitting the load balancer get inconsistent cursors. Looks like someone hand-edited the config on node three back in spring and it never got synced to the repo. No auth impact that I can see, but flagging for security review anyway. The intended baseline values are as follows.

settings of tagef-bawif:
DRUIX_HOST=druix.zemvarlabs.internal
DRUIX_PORT=8000

### Add Fabrikit seed-data factory

This PR adds Fabrikit, a small factory library so our integration tests stop hand-rolling user and order fixtures. Factories are deterministic given a seed, and the generator pools are sized to avoid collisions in parallel runs. Nothing fancy — mostly boilerplate removal. The pool sizes and seed parameters are tuned as shown below.

tuning constants:
QUOTAS = {
    "druwyn": 5,
    "holix": 5,
    "zorath": 5,
    "holwyn": 10,
}

Facilities Ticket — Cleaning Crew Access, Brindle Annex

For new starters handling evening lock-up: the Sorano Cleaning crew arrives nightly at 21:30 via the annex side door. Check their rota sheet, note arrival in the log, and ensure the storeroom is relocked afterward. To let them through the side door, enter the access code below.

badge for yaweg-hafog: bdg-GX-6

Ticket: Vault locked during DNS flakiness investigation

While debugging intermittent resolution failures in the Quillhaven resolver pool, I triggered three failed auth attempts against the secrets vault and it self-locked. The flaky lookups appear tied to a stale cache entry, not the resolver patch under review, so please don't block the PR on this. To reproduce my traces, you'll need read access to the captured packet logs stored in the vault. Unlock it with the recovery passphrase below.

unlock words, yawig-kagef: gordor-holvan-ulaael-pramir-ulaiel-tamdor